Citrus Systems Recalls Nature's Nectar Orange Juice for Pasteurization Failure
Citrus Systems Inc is recalling Nature's Nectar High Pulp Orange Juice because the product cannot be verified as having achieved the required 5-log reduction per 21 CFR 120.

Plain-English summary
Citrus Systems Inc is recalling Nature's Nectar High Pulp Orange Juice, Never from Concentrate, Item # 420025. The product is a 52 FL OZ (1.53L) pasteurized orange juice distributed by Aldi, Inc. in Batavia, IL. The recall involves 1,142 cases, with 6 units per case.
The recall was initiated because the product cannot be verified as having achieved a 5-log reduction per 21 CFR 120. This regulation pertains to the pasteurization process required to ensure the safety of the juice. The affected product has a code of 04/12/2019 and was distributed in Kansas, Minnesota, and Wisconsin.
Consumers who purchased this product should check their refrigerators for the specific item and UPC code 4 099100 056907. If found, consumers should stop using the product and follow instructions from the recalling firm or retailer for disposal or return.
